The main difference between his love for Rosaline and Juliet is that he did not love Rosaline for anything but her beautiful looks while he fell in love with Juliet for both her looks and personality.
The first time he meets Juliet he realizes this and expresses it on a sonnet by stating ''Did my hear love till now? Forswear it, sight''.
His feelings are manifested by his actions, the moment he realizes his love for Juliet he decides to marry her despite the circumstances.
At the beggining of the play Benvolio states that Romeo's love for Rosaline is mainly a puppy love; Then later on, we discover that Romeo's love for Juliet is described as the one true love, they then become starcrossed lovers.

The message is the lesson or moral, also known as the theme. What is the model millionaire trying teach you? The easiest way to determine this is the ask, what does the author believe? For example, in Finding Nemo, we could say, the author believes that family is an important part of your life as they are your support system. Remove "the author believes that", and what you have left is the important message/theme, which is...
Family is an important part of your life as they are your support system.
